Thermostat

The thermostat is one of the most crucial components of your oven, assisting to ensure that the temperature of your food is in line with the temperature you've set on the control panel. Unfortunately, like any other electronic mechanical switch or sensor, it may have issues that can cause the oven to over or under heat, or just not be able to keep the temperature at what you've set.

The oven thermostat is tiny strips of two different metals joined. When heated the various metals expand and contract at different rates, creating or breaking an electrical circuit. When the metal in your thermostat reaches the temperature you set on the control panel it will shut off heating element's power. As the oven cools it expands the bimetallic strip in a circuit, re-establishing it and turning on heating element. This cycle is repeated continuously to ensure that the oven remains at a constant temperature.

Bake Element

The bake element is crucial to the operation of your oven. It provides heat that allows it to cook food. It's a simple element that transforms electricity into high temperatures for baking, roasting, and broiling. Electric ovens and ranges usually include heating elements that are either visible or hidden under the floor.

In general oven heating elements are made up of high-resistance elements like nickel-chromium. They work by converting electrical energy into heat using resistance. The heat then radiates through the oven's interior to attain the desired temperature to cook various types of food.

When you turn on the oven, the heating elements begin to produce heat through the high-voltage current flowing across the metal's surface. The element is a ribbon or coil (straight or corrugated) of wire, and as the electric current passes through it, it starts to get hotter. The element will appear red hot when it reaches the temperature you want.

The baked element is the main source of heat for most oven functions. It's usually found in the bottom of the oven, and is used for the self-cleaning feature in a variety of ovens that are automatic. Broil Element

The broil element, usually found at the top of your cavity allows high-temperature heat to cook or char the food. The broil setting of your oven is an excellent option for quickly grilling meat and vegetables, crisping up vegetables, warming lasagna, or making caramel on top of the casserole.

Similar to the bake element, the broiler heating element transforms electrical energy into heat via the process of resistance. It consists of an inner core of wires made of metal wrapped in an insulating expanded perlite material. The inner core of the element is then covered with a stainless steel outer layer to protect the wires against direct contact with the oven. The three-layer structure reduces the broil element's temperature which makes it more durable and safer than older types of elements.

Vent Tube

The vent tube is an important oven part that allows for an airflow within the cavity. This allows the bake element to circulate heat around the oven and ensures the temperature is evenly distributed.

It also allows the vapors be released from the oven, and smoke to be drawn from the cooking surface. It is necessary for the proper operation of any gas or electric oven.

Vents in ovens can get blocked or blocked due to several factors. Accidental spills and splatters during cooking can leave sticky residues on the oven vents, which could attract dust and other debris that could eventually cause blockages or clogs over time. Grease and oil particles may become airborne and settle around the vents, as well. Other environmental factors such as construction and kitchen renovations can introduce dust into the vents.
